How to Choose the Right Retreat: Tips for Beginners and Experienced Participants
-
Define Your Goals. What do you want to achieve? Relaxation, spiritual growth, or physical changes? Knowing your intentions will help you choose the right program.
-
Study the Program. Pay attention to the schedule of classes, duration, and style of practices. Some retreats focus on yoga, others on meditation or art therapy.
-
Check Reviews. Learn about the opinions of participants to understand the atmosphere and quality of the program.
-
Ensure Professional Instructors Are Available. Experienced mentors can greatly enrich your experience.
-
Learn About Accommodation. Living and dining conditions also play a significant role. Choose retreats with comfortable amenities so you can focus on your practice.

Budget and Financial Aspects

When planning to participate in the retreat in Bali, it is important to assess what expenses you can expect in advance. This will help avoid any unexpected surprises and make your experience more comfortable and mindful.
Approximate Participation Budget: What is Included in the Retreat Cost
The cost of participation in our retreat in Bali includes:
-
Accommodation: This usually consists of comfortable rooms in a hotel or villa. The living conditions can vary from standard to more luxurious, depending on your choice.
-
Meals: The program includes all main meals. You will enjoy a variety of dishes, including vegetarian and vegan options, made from fresh local ingredients.
-
Activity Program: This may include meditations, yoga, workshops, and other practices led by qualified instructors. It is an important part of your experience that helps you immerse yourself in the retreat atmosphere.
-
Transfers: Often, the cost includes transfers from the airport to the accommodation and back.
The approximate budget ranges from $800 to $2000 USD for a week, depending on the chosen program and level of comfort.
Hidden Costs: What to Keep in Mind
Although most expenses are included in the price, there are a few points to consider:
-
Additional Services: Some workshops or individual consultations may require extra payment. Please check in advance what is included in the program.
-
Personal Expenses: Keep in mind the possibility of purchasing souvenirs, participating in excursions, or additional entertainment. These expenses can vary, so it’s best to allocate a separate budget for personal needs.
-
Insurance: Be sure to consider health insurance. This can be an important aspect of your safety during the trip.
